Civil War Veteran

Private, Co. H, 1st Minnesota Heavy Artillery



Ephraim was the second son born to Menno and Catherine (Fisher) Eby in Ontario, Canada. The Eby family moved to Jackson Co., Minnesota around 1855.


Ephraim and Josephine "Phenie" Norman were married in Jackson, MN on November 26, 1871. They were blessed with five children: Nettie Mae (Eby) Sowles; Edith Eby [1877-1960]; Florence "Flossie" (Eby) Griffin; Grace Rose (Eby) McKenney; and Harrison Norman "Harry" Eby.
